After losing to Normal West the last time they met, Deer Creek-Mackinaw decided to demonstrate that turnabout is fair play. The Chiefs came out on top against the Wildcats by a score of 2-0 on Saturday. The win was a breath of fresh air for the Chiefs as it put an end to their three-game losing streak.
Deer Creek-Mackinaw's victory bumped their record up to 5-7. As for Normal West, they have been struggling recently as they've lost three of their last four contests. That's put a noticeable dent in their 6-8 record this season.
Deer Creek-Mackinaw has already played their next matchup (against Williamsville), but no score has been uploaded at the time of writing. As for Normal West, they will challenge Champaign Central at 7:00 p.m. on Tuesday.
